while it looks nice some practical / cost observations:
- square rack mounting holes are a no-go. like round ones or too small (had to open all Sonic interfaces to fit our M6 racks).
- if the meters only show gain reduction two are redundant in this piece of gear (those meters are expensive, and both will always show the same).
- this little Power Switch ... might be some tiny toggle exists for 240V AC, however, next to the others the user will fail sooner or later ;)
